Core Web Vitals: The New Marketing Currency
Google's Core Web Vitals have emerged as critical metrics that no marketer can ignore. These user-centric performance measurements--Largest Contentful Paint (LCP), Interaction to Next Paint (INP), and Cumulative Layout Shift (CLS)--directly impact search rankings, advertising Quality Scores, and user behavior metrics that determine campaign success.

Largest Contentful Paint (LCP): The First Impression Metric
LCP measures how quickly the largest visible content element renders on a page. For marketing purposes, this metric directly correlates with bounce rates--a user who waits more than 2.5 seconds for the primary content to appear is significantly more likely to abandon the page before engaging with marketing messages.
Interaction to Next Paint (INP): Responsiveness Matters
INP measures the latency of all interactions throughout a page's lifecycle. Marketing pages with forms, buttons, and interactive elements suffer directly when INP scores are poor--users attempting to click calls-to-action experience frustrating delays that translate directly into lost leads.
Cumulative Layout Shift (CLS): Stability Builds Trust
CLS quantifies visual stability by measuring unexpected layout shifts during page loading. When content causes elements to shift after the user has begun interacting, the experience feels broken and unprofessional. For marketing pages, layout stability builds the visual trust necessary for conversion.
Optimize Largest Contentful Paint
Improve server response times, implement lazy loading for below-fold content, and use modern image formats to achieve LCP under 2.5 seconds.
Minimize Interaction Delays
Reduce JavaScript execution time, break up long tasks, and defer non-critical scripts to improve INP responsiveness scores.
Prevent Layout Shifts
Reserve space for images and ads, use CSS aspect-ratio properties, and avoid inserting content above existing elements.
Implement Edge Delivery
Deploy CDN edge nodes to serve content from locations near users, reducing latency for global marketing audiences.
Edge Computing: Bringing Marketing Content Closer
The integration of edge computing with content delivery networks represents a fundamental shift in how marketers can deliver content globally. Edge computing moves data processing from centralized servers to geographically distributed edge nodes, reducing latency and improving the speed of content delivery.
For internet marketing, this technological advancement translates into tangible benefits. Marketing assets--images, videos, interactive content, and personalized elements--load faster when processed at edge locations near the user. Faster loading improves every Core Web Vitals metric while enhancing the effectiveness of campaigns that rely on rich media.
Modern web development practices increasingly incorporate edge delivery as a standard component of performance-focused marketing infrastructure. Brands serving international audiences can now deliver consistent, fast experiences regardless of geographic location.
Key edge computing benefits for marketing:
- Reduced latency for global audiences
- Improved Core Web Vitals scores across regions
- Better handling of traffic spikes from campaigns
- Enhanced personalization at the edge
- Increased resilience and availability

Best Practices for Performance-First Internet Marketing
Continuous Performance Monitoring
Effective performance-focused marketing requires ongoing monitoring rather than one-time optimization. Core Web Vitals fluctuate based on content changes, traffic patterns, and device diversity. Establish monitoring protocols that track performance across key pages and trigger optimization when needed.
AI-powered automation tools can enhance marketing performance monitoring by providing real-time insights and automated optimization recommendations. These systems continuously analyze user behavior and performance metrics to identify improvement opportunities.
Mobile Performance Priority
Mobile devices dominate internet usage, making mobile performance optimization essential. Marketing strategies must prioritize mobile experience, ensuring landing pages, product pages, and conversion funnels perform flawlessly on smartphones and tablets.
Third-Party Script Management
Marketing technologies--analytics tools, advertising pixels, and tracking scripts--accumulate on pages, each impacting performance. Regular audits ensure each script delivers value proportional to its performance cost.
Progressive Enhancement
Rich media and interactive elements engage audiences but must not compromise performance. Progressive enhancement ensures core content renders immediately while enhanced experiences load for capable browsers and fast connections.
